2.
Ongoing Research:
Last month, another researcher from a major university contacted the MRF to find out how he could get involved, and he was provided with samples to analyze. We are currently working with researchers at three major universities and a microbiologist at a private lab. These four groups of researchers are examining the chemical composition of the fibers and also examining them microscopically. In addition, DNA analysis is being performed on specimens. No conclusions have been reached so far from this research. We will post any and all new information about research findings on our website, and will also email the information to you, as part of our newsletter updates. We want to thank all of these researchers for their dedicated efforts.

The funding of scientific research continues to be a major priority for the MRF. The MRF has provided "start up" funding to researchers at three U.S. universities, and we have recently received two new grant applications from other researchers. The MRF, which is operated by a non-salaried volunteer board of directors and officers, will continue to give research grants to new researchers as we are able.

6.
Morgellons Patient Data:

The MRF has helped fund the collection and collation of laboratory data, as well as demographic, history and physical information from 25 Morgellons patients, who were examined by two physicians. We will share information from the analysis of this data with you when the final report of this data is complete.
